This article tries to understand the various meanings implied in social policies from the angle of social policy practice in its historical development.It will reveal the origin of the definition of social policy as a plan for social action and welfare philosophy,and explore the basic contents of the theory of social policy studies in its background,goals,contents,nature and belief,as well as methodology.The paper will demonstrate the role of the government,market and the third sector in deciding the nature of social policy or,the distribution of social resources through the history of rise,decline and rise again of the third sector in Europe and America during the century. In view of the fact that there is a difference in perception in decision making and the making of a national social policy,the decision making can only be a process of mutual adjustment and coordination.The social scientists participating in the process need to strengthen the ability of engaging in the spreading of scientific view and methodology,to try their best to be coordinators among all forces.
